One of my last chicken dishes. I have 2 more portions of chicken, one more can of tuna then I'm 100% veggie!

This actually turned out really good! I put the chicken breast in the crock pot and let them cook, shredding them when they were done. I added 2 cans of diced tomatoes, a can of corn, and a can of black beans. I let that cook for a couple of hours then added a can of cream of chicken soup and a package of refrigerated cornbread twists, torn into small pieces to be the "dumplings". Another hour or so on high and I had a very yummy meal!
